Implementing Knowledge Management Systems can present significant challenges for organizations due to the complexity involved in capturing, storing, sharing, and utilizing knowledge across different departments and functions. A notable case is BP, the multinational oil and gas company, which struggled with knowledge management during the Deepwater Horizon oil spill in 2010. The lack of effective knowledge sharing and retrieval mechanisms hindered the timely response to the crisis, resulting in severe environmental damage and reputational harm. Another example is Siemens, a global engineering and technology company, which implemented a knowledge management system to enhance collaboration and innovation. By centralizing knowledge resources and providing easy access to information, Siemens achieved greater efficiency and improved decision-making processes.
To successfully navigate the challenges of implementing Knowledge Management Systems, organizations should consider adopting methodologies such as the SECI model, developed by Nonaka and Takeuchi. This model focuses on socialization, externalization, combination, and internalization of knowledge to facilitate the creation and sharing of tacit and explicit knowledge within the organization. Additionally, it is crucial for organizations to prioritize cultural change, leadership support, and employee training to foster a knowledge-sharing culture. Emphasizing the importance of continuous learning, feedback mechanisms, and technologies that enable seamless knowledge transfer can greatly enhance the effectiveness of Knowledge Management Systems. By learning from the experiences of companies like BP and Siemens, organizations can proactively address the challenges associated with knowledge management and leverage their intellectual assets for competitive advantage.

Managing IT infrastructure in knowledge management systems can pose significant challenges for organizations across various industries. One real-world example is that of BMW Group, a renowned automotive company, which had to navigate technology hurdles when implementing knowledge management systems to streamline its global operations. BMW prioritized aligning its IT infrastructure with the knowledge sharing needs of employees to ensure smooth integration and adoption of new systems. By focusing on effective communication, training sessions, and continuous monitoring of the IT infrastructure, BMW successfully overcame the technology hurdles in its knowledge management initiative.
Another case is that of Airbnb, a leading hospitality service platform. As the company grew rapidly, it faced challenges in managing its IT infrastructure to support the vast amount of knowledge shared among hosts and guests on the platform. Airbnb invested in a robust IT ecosystem that could scale with its expansion, incorporating cloud-based solutions and agile methodologies to enhance knowledge management processes. By proactively addressing technology hurdles and prioritizing data security, Airbnb was able to maintain a high level of customer satisfaction and operational efficiency in its knowledge sharing systems.
For readers encountering similar technology hurdles in managing IT infrastructure for knowledge management systems, it is essential to adopt methodologies such as ITIL (Information Technology Infrastructure Library) to align IT services with business needs effectively. Implementing a structured approach like ITIL can help organizations streamline their IT processes, improve communication between departments, and enhance overall knowledge management capabilities. Additionally, investing in regular IT infrastructure audits, staff training programs, and staying updated on technological advancements can empower organizations to address technology hurdles proactively and optimize their knowledge management systems for long-term success.

In today's rapidly evolving digital landscape, striking a delicate balance between security and access to sensitive information in knowledge management systems has become a paramount challenge for organizations worldwide. One notable case is that of Equifax, a consumer credit reporting agency, which suffered a massive data breach in 2017 that exposed sensitive personal information of over 147 million customers. This breach occurred due to a combination of inadequate security measures and improper access controls within their knowledge management system, highlighting the immense repercussions of failing to address this critical issue effectively.
On the other hand, a success story in managing this challenge comes from the financial services firm, JPMorgan Chase. By implementing a comprehensive security framework based on the Zero Trust model, JPMorgan Chase has successfully enhanced security while still allowing appropriate access to sensitive information for authorized personnel. This proactive approach has not only fortified their knowledge management systems but also boosted customer trust and confidence in the company's commitment to data protection. For organizations grappling with similar dilemmas, adopting a Zero Trust security model, which assumes all network traffic is untrusted, can be a highly effective methodology aligned with the issue of balancing security and access. By implementing stringent access controls, continuous monitoring, and encryption technologies, companies can mitigate risks and safeguard sensitive data within their knowledge management systems.
In facing the challenges of protecting sensitive information in knowledge management systems, organizations must prioritize a proactive security strategy that ensures a secure yet accessible environment. Conducting regular security assessments, monitoring access permissions, encrypting data, and implementing multi-factor authentication are practical recommendations to bolster defenses against potential breaches. Additionally, fostering a culture of cybersecurity awareness among employees and stakeholders is crucial in creating a unified front against internal and external threats. By embracing the principles of a Zero Trust model and integrating robust security measures with streamlined access protocols, organizations can navigate the complex landscape of data security with confidence and resilience, ultimately safeguarding their valuable assets and preserving trust in an increasingly interconnected world.
